We're looking for a Civil Engineering Team Lead who is passionate about delivering quality engineering solutions and tackling complex technical challenges. In this role, you'll lead the design and execution of commercial, industrial, energy, utility, and community projects throughout the Midwest, working alongside a talented team of engineers to bring projects from concept to completion.
We're seeking someone with strong technical expertise, sound engineering judgment, and a collaborative approach to problem-solving. You'll play a hands-on role in the design process while also leading project teams —delegating work, providing technical guidance, and helping engineers successfully deliver high-quality results. From developing innovative solutions to overseeing project execution, you'll help ensure projects are completed efficiently, accurately, and with excellence at every stage.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ead and mentor a team of civil engineers and designers, overseeing day-to-day project execution and team performance.
- Coordinate and collaborate with internal teams across multiple disciplines including Surveying, Geotechnical, Structural, Traffic, Transportation, and Environmental Engineering.
- Oversee and review the development of construction documents, including plan sets, specifications, and bid packages.
- Manage complete site civil design for private development projects, including site layout, grading, utility and SWPP plans.
- Oversee preparation of feasibility studies, due diligence reports, zoning analyses, stormwater modeling and design, cost estimates, and detailed engineering plans.
- Perform and review design calculations, ensuring technical accuracy and compliance with applicable codes and standards.
- Lead communication with clients and reviewing agencies to resolve comments and ensure smooth project approvals.
- Foster a culture of quality, collaboration, and continuous improvement within the team.
Skills, Knowledge and Expertise
- Bachelor’s degree in Civil Engineering
- PE license in Ohio, Michigan, Pennsylvania or Indiana required
- 8+ years of experience in civil engineering, including experience in a leadership or supervisory role.
- Proficiency in AutoCAD/Civil 3D required.
- Proven experience in independent preparation of stormwater management reports and designs.
- Solid understanding of design and plan preparation for site development projects.
- Experience with roadway design and survey coordination is a plus.
- Demonstrated ability to manage multiple projects and de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
- Strong interpersonal and communication skills with the ability to guide junior staff and engage effectively with stakeholders.
